Output 213323f51d508a621fd2eced03ddf5388a7f0b8b60fb0f1f0f5d75a91a7a2814:2

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d2094424ce91a3400b185fc2476010286a895d OP_EQUAL
address
ADa2NGofofCHBL4V64Hat1sgQEaFtXehgr
transaction
213323f51d508a621fd2eced03ddf5388a7f0b8b60fb0f1f0f5d75a91a7a2814